I don't dislike Daredevil because Colin Farrell is very entertaining as Bullseye and the late, great, Michael Clarke Duncan is superbly cast as Wilson Fisk/Kingpin, but it always seems like there is a better film available with the source material and the talented ensemble cast.
I really like the TV series because Charlie Cox is a better Matt Murdock/Daredevil than Ben Affleck was, I love the relationships with Foggy and Karen, and Vincent D'Onofrio gives Fisk a nuance and depth which isn't in the film, helped by the additional time to tell the story and develop the characters.
